A Prospective, Randomized, Blind, Controlled Multicenter Clinical Study Comparing the Effectiveness of Preventive Ventricular Arrhythmia Ablation on the Prognosis After Left Ventricular Assist Device (LVAD) Surgery.

To compare the preventive effect of preventive ventricular arrhythmia ablation on the composite events 30 days after surgery in the study population. The composite events defined in this study 30 days after surgery include persistent ventricular tachycardia/ventricular fibrillation, all-cause death, mechanical thrombosis and right heart failure.

Inclusion criteria

  • 1.voluntary and with the provision of an informed consent form 2.males or females aged 18 years or older 3.all patients with acute and critical or chronic advanced heart failure who have failed to respond to standardized oral medication and are scheduled to undergo artificial heart implantation surgery

Exclusion criteria

  • 1.The left ventricular assist system is prohibited for patients who cannot tolerate anticoagulant therapy or who are allergic to anticoagulant treatment.

2.Doctors with sufficient experience will make a comprehensive judgment based on the patient's physical condition, body surface area, and the anatomical-related conditions of the planned implantation site, and determine those who are not suitable for the implantation procedure.

3.Pregnant women. 4.Systemic active infection. 5.Patients in a state of brain death. 6.Irreversible severe liver or kidney dysfunction. 7.Having a history of severe chronic obstructive pulmonary disease (COPD) or restrictive lung disease.

8.primary pulmonary hypertension. 9.Having a confirmed and untreated history of abdominal or thoracic aortic aneurysm with a diameter greater than 5 cm.

10.Patients with severe atherosclerotic plaques in the aorta. 11.Having mental disorders/impairments, irreversible cognitive dysfunction, or social-psychological problems, which makes it possible for the patient to fail to comply with the application management regulations of the implanted left ventricular assist device.

12.Preoperative conditions included end-stage organ failure, such as renal failure (requiring hemodialysis), liver failure, respiratory failure; and concurrent malignant tumors or any severe accompanying diseases with an expected lifespan of less than 3 years.

Treatment and study plan

preventive ablation group

Procedure

for patients undergoing LVAD surgery while also undergoing prophylactic ablation of ventricular arrhythmias at the same time

Primary outcomes

  1. persistent ventricular tachycardia / ventricular fibrillation

    Time frame: Continuous electrocardiogram monitoring for 30 days after surgery

    Electrocardiogram monitoring was conducted daily for the patients 30 days after the surgery. Data were uploaded daily and the frequency of arrhythmia occurrences was statistically analyzed.

  2. all-cause mortality

    Time frame: Within 30 days after the operation

    Conduct a 30-day follow-up visit for the patients, and collect the time and cause of death.

  3. mechanical thrombus

    Time frame: Within 30 days after the operation

    Electrocardiogram monitoring was performed daily on the patients 30 days after the surgery. When thrombosis occurred, the left heart assist device would give an alarm to alert. In some cases, autopsy could be conducted to obtain the results.

  4. right heart failure

    Time frame: Within 30 days after the operation

    Conduct a 30-day follow-up visit for the patients, and collect the time and cause of right heart failure.
